
Senior Functional Analyst
Stefanini Brasil
full-time
Posted on:
Location Type: Hybrid
Location: São Paulo • Brazil
Visit company websiteExplore more
Job Level
About the role
- Gather requirements from business areas, ensuring clarity, completeness and traceability of requests.
- Translate business needs into structured functional specifications, including business rules, flows, integrations and acceptance criteria.
- Lead meetings with stakeholders to understand, refine and validate requirements, ensuring alignment between business and technology.
- Lead functional and technical refinement sessions with squads, anticipating risks, dependencies and systemic impacts.
- Map and analyze business processes (AS-IS / TO-BE), identifying bottlenecks, inconsistencies and improvement opportunities.
- Produce functional and technical documentation, such as:
- user stories
- use cases
- process flows
- diagrams
- integration specifications
- Detail integrations between systems, including:
- API contracts
- payloads
- validation rules
- exception flows
- Support the definition and execution of test cases and validation scenarios, ensuring adherence to defined requirements.
- Act as a bridge between business, technology, vendors and regulatory areas, ensuring clear communication and continuous alignment.
- Track the full lifecycle of requests, from conception to deployment, ensuring quality and consistency of deliverables.
- Actively participate in UAT (User Acceptance Testing) phases, supporting validations and necessary adjustments.
- Support incident analysis and functional troubleshooting, identifying root causes and defining solutions.
Requirements
- Solid experience in functional analysis, requirements elicitation and system specification.
- Experience in environments with system integrations and distributed architecture.
- Knowledge of agile methodologies (Scrum/Kanban) and/or traditional models.
- Experience with structured documentation of requirements and business rules.
- Knowledge of integrations via APIs (REST / SOAP), including tools such as Postman or SoapUI.
- Ability to perform data analysis and troubleshooting, including database queries (SQL).
- Experience working with multiple stakeholders in complex environments.
- Excellent communication, organization and prioritization skills.
- Analytical profile, focused on problem solving and delivery quality.
- Nice to have / Differentials
- Experience in the financial or banking sector.
- Experience with systems such as:
- Pix
- checking/current accounts
- billing
- credit
- acquiring/acquirer services
- Experience with systems or platforms such as Autbank.
- Knowledge of messaging systems (Kafka, queues, events).
- Experience with process modeling (BPMN).
- Experience with functional testing and test automation.
- Knowledge or experience using Artificial Intelligence to support requirements analysis, documentation or productivity.
Benefits
- Meal allowance or meal voucher
- Discounts on courses, universities and language schools
- Stefanini Academy — platform with free, up-to-date online courses and certificates
- Mentoring
- Benefits club for medical consultations and exams
- Healthcare coverage
- Dental coverage
- Discount club with offers at top establishments
- Travel club
- Pet care plan
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
functional analysisrequirements elicitationsystem specificationdata analysistroubleshootingdatabase queriesAPI integrationsprocess modelingfunctional testingtest automation
Soft Skills
communicationorganizationprioritizationanalytical thinkingproblem solving